免費手游
在學習前端開發(fā)的過程中,理解 Vue.js 是一項非常重要的技能。Vue.js 是一個流行的 JavaScript 框架,用于構建用戶界面和單頁應用。通過深入淺出的方式學習 Vue.js,可以幫助初學者迅速掌握其核心概念和實際應用。本篇文章將結合相關視頻資料,詳細解析如何從 JavaScript 的角度理解和使用 Vue.js,讓你在前端開發(fā)的路上走得更順暢。
我們要了解什么是 Vue.js。Vue.js 是一種漸進式框架,意味著你可以逐步引入它,而不必一次性重構整個項目。它主要關注視圖層,所以特別適合用來開發(fā)單頁應用。學習 Vue.js 的基本概念,包括組件、指令和數據綁定,是入門的第一步。
在 Vue.js 中,組件是構建應用的核心部分。每一個組件都可以看作是一個獨立的小應用,它們擁有自己的數據和方法。通過組件化開發(fā),代碼變得更加模塊化,維護和擴展也更為簡單。目前很多現代前端框架都采用了這種設計思想,因此掌握組件的創(chuàng)建和使用至關重要。
Vue.js 提供了非常強大的數據綁定功能。這種雙向數據綁定的機制使得模型和視圖之間的同步變得更加簡單。你只需更新數據,視圖就會自動反映這些變化。這種響應式系統(tǒng)的實現原理是 Vue.js 的核心之一,理解它能幫助你更好地應對復雜的交互邏輯。
在 Vue.js 中,指令是用來在模板中控制 DOM 的特殊標記。比如,v-if、v-for 和 v-bind 等指令可以幫助你動態(tài)渲染頁面內容。掌握這些指令的用法,可以讓你在開發(fā)時更加靈活高效。通過示例視頻,你可以直觀地看到如何在實際項目中應用這些指令。
對于大型應用來說,路由管理和狀態(tài)管理都是不可或缺的部分。Vue Router 讓你可以輕松地創(chuàng)建單頁應用的導航,而 Vuex 則是最新推薦的狀態(tài)管理模式。通過學習如何使用這兩者,你能夠更好地組織你的應用結構,提高可維護性和可擴展性。
理論知識固然重要,但實際操作更能鞏固學習效果。在視頻中,一些項目實例展示了如何將 Vue.js 應用于真實場景。無論是簡單的待辦事項應用,還是復雜的電商平臺,通過實踐,你會發(fā)現 Vue.js 的強大之處,并能將所學知識靈活運用。
通過以上各個方面的學習,Vue.js 的基本概念以及應用方法已經逐漸清晰。掌握了這些知識,你將在前端開發(fā)的道路上走得更遠。隨著技術的不斷發(fā)展,保持學習和實踐的熱情,才能跟上時代的步伐。
蜜桃作為一種非常受歡迎的水果,憑借其獨特的口感和營養(yǎng)價值,已成為許多人餐桌上的??汀T谥袊?,蜜桃的產區(qū)眾多,各個產區(qū)的氣候、土壤條件不同,導致了蜜桃的口味和質量上存在一些顯著的差異。了解蜜桃精產國品一
進入專區(qū)>Copyright 2025 //m.xinshilikeji.com/ 版權所有 豫ICP備2021037741號-1 網站地圖